To restore a database to a point in time, you first restore the full backup, followed by the subsequent transaction log backups up to that point. Before you can create the first log backup, you will need to create a full backup. The transaction log is a critical component of the database and if there is a system failure, the transaction log might be required to bring your database back to a consistent state. Overview of transaction log and backupsĮvery SQL Server database has a transaction log that records transactions and the database modifications that are made by each transaction. In this post, we examine a use case in which you achieve database-level point-in-time recovery (PITR) on Amazon RDS for SQL Server using the transaction log backups feature. Now you can access these transaction log backup files and copy them to an S3 bucket in your own account. Amazon RDS for SQL Server takes periodic transaction log backups in an AWS managed Amazon Simple Storage Service (Amazon S3) bucket. To overcome this challenge, Amazon RDS for SQL Server introduced access to transaction log backups. However, this process requires additional time to perform manual steps, and you still need to pay for the compute, storage, and license costs for the newly restored instance on AWS. Today, you can achieve database-level PITR by restoring the Amazon RDS for SQL Server snapshot as a new DB instance and then copying the required database from the newly restored instance to the target DB instance using SQL Server native backup and restore. Customers running their Microsoft SQL Server workloads on Amazon RDS for SQL Server ask us how they can perform a point-in-time recovery (PITR) at the individual database level.
